Choosing the Right Link for IoT and Sensor Traffic

Environmental sensors, access events, submetering, and equipment health beacons send small, periodic payloads. Treating every endpoint like a bandwidth-hungry WLAN client creates cost and complexity you do not need.

High-bandwidth workloads

Cameras, access control, signage, and VoIP need predictable throughput and low jitter. Put them on engineered Wi‑Fi with VLAN policy or on copper/fiber where paths exist. If a vendor app assumes always-on cloud connectivity, plan AP density and switch capacity accordingly.

Low-power telemetry

Temperature probes, leak sensors, and remote door contacts often send a few bytes per hour. LPWAN-style links reduce battery changes and avoid provisioning dozens of Wi‑Fi credentials across a large footprint.

Design in layers

Most sites combine business internet and managed Wi‑Fi for people, switched Ethernet for fixed gear, and an LPWAN overlay for telemetry. Match each workload to a link that is secure, maintainable, and economical — not one radio for everything.
